I recently received an email from one of the Daring Dreamers who has done one of the Dream Mapping and Goal Setting Workshops.  She has a very intersting question, which may unlock something for you in your own life….

Donna, there’s something I’d like to ask you about that we didn’t discuss about manifesting your dreams and goals. Sometimes the way we feel about ourselves prevents us from achieving our dreams. For example, we may want to be rich and famous (sorry, very obvious example!), but inside don’t feel as though we deserve that fame or wealth, or both, and so keep sabotaging that dream, no matter how many affirmations or visualisations we do. What would be the way around this? How would you suggest someone deals with this?
And how do you find out what your core belief about your dream may be?

Dear Daring Dreamer

Thank you so much for your very valid question!   Yes – I certainly know about the concept that our core inner beliefs determine our reality.  However in my work, I don’t necessarily believe that one should go back to the basic negative belief and then try and “root” it out.  This is almost like believing that there is something “wrong” with us, that we have to fix or change before we live our dreams…. I don’t think that this is necessarily the case.

The exercise of visualizing your WIG (wildly improbable goal) or dream, every morning for 5 minutes using all 5 senses for a period of 30 days is the best way of changing past behaviours and patterns.  I see that you mention that people keep “sabotaging” their dreams no matter how many affirmations or visualizations they do – this is not really the case.  What happens is that people do their affirmations or visualizations for a week or two and don’t see immediate results and then give up.  We are a society obsessed with immediate results, we live in what I call a “microwave-era” where a meal that used to take 2 hours to prepare now takes 1 minute – we want results and we want them NOW, and we are not really prepared to put in the work to get them.   The problem is that most people lack the discipline to do the affirmations or 5 senses outcome  (I call it this rather than visualization, because it is about using all 5 senses) every day for 30 days and then blame the lack of results on “self-sabotage” or deep seated beliefs that they don’t have any control over… this is a very convenient way of going back into victim mentality eg. “my beliefs run me”  rather than “wow, if I do this every day for 30 days, my life will be transformed”.

So the way around this or the tools that you need are to do the exercises that I have explained to you in the workshop everyday for 30 days.
